CMS 'Extreme Backlog' Prompts Pause Of $7.6M Recoupment
By Jess Krochtengel ( June 28, 2018, 8:32 PM EDT) -- A Texas federal judge on Thursday blocked the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services from recouping $7.6 million in alleged Medicare overpayments from a Texas home health care agency that said it would go bankrupt while waiting out an "extreme backlog" for an administrative appeal....
